Arab Primary School

121 Mimosa St Ne
Arab, AL 35016
(School attendance zone shown in map)
Arab Primary School serves 718 students in grades Prekindergarten-2. 
The student:teacher ratio of 18:1 is equal to the Alabama state level of 18:1.
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Alabama state average of 47% (majority Black).
